## Approvals: Websocket Reconnect Fix

This page tracks sign-off for the patch addressing the reconnect storm in the Pondbridge gateway, where dropped websocket sessions retried without backoff and overwhelmed the edge nodes. The fix adds jittered exponential backoff and caps concurrent reconnect attempts per client. QA has verified behavior under simulated network flaps, and load testing passed on staging. Before we schedule the rollout, we need one final approval per our change policy. The approver responsible for this change is named below.

account owner for tawip-kahop: Oliok Jorix Ulaath Quenok

## Lintwright: rule engine pass

Lintwright scans doc sources in a single pass. Rules are pure functions; no shared state. Severity thresholds gate CI: errors block, warnings annotate. Line-length and heading-depth checks are configurable per repo via `lintwright.toml`. Defaults were chosen from a scan of the Farrow docs corpus. The constants below control batching and rule cutoffs.

limits module of yadug-tawip:
QUOTAS = {
    "julael": 705,
    "kasael": 903,
    "druwyn": 489,
}

// Broker upgrade: Mistralux 3.x -> 4.x (Kestrel Queue service).
// 4.x enforces TLS on inter-node links and drops plaintext fallback;
// handshake timeouts were retuned accordingly. Heartbeat intervals
// shortened so partition detection beats the new election timeout.
// Security review: confirm none of these widen the unauthenticated
// window during rolling restarts. Constants below are the agreed
// upgrade baseline:

tuning table, faduf-baduf:
PRIORITIES = {
    "ulavan": 191,
    "silys": 750,
    "goriel": 238,
    "kelmir": 66,
    "wendor": 432,
}